Harry Potter Practical Effects You Thought Were CGI
Creating the world of Harry Potter had a lot more real magic behind the scenes than we would have expected. While CGI played its part, tons of major and surprising special effects were done practically with handmade mechanisms and camera tricks.
For the most part, the animals we see on set were actually there - including the phoenix, Fawkes! Whether the animals were real or a shockingly convincing creation, fully equipped to be able to move around seemingly on their own - they brought major realism and true magic to the screen.
The Wizard’s chess set was larger than life - literally! Rupert Grint actually got to sit on a giant chess piece. The doors of the Chamber of Secrets and many Gringotts vaults looked too good to be true, but those were actually created and included a ton of intricate detail to really bring the fantasy. When casting spells, CGI was a major contributor, creating the lights we see flying out of wands - all except for one - the “Lumos” light!
Not many people get to experience what it would feel like to literally inflate - but the actress who played Aunt Marge lived the experience on set while wearing multiple inflatable costumes and enduring multiple makeup and prosthetic changes. Mad-Eye Moody actor Brendan Gleeson also got to experience a fake magical eye like his character - the main difference being the one Gleeson used was equipped with a radio controller!
Daniel Radcliffe, Emma Watson and Rupert Grint really got to experience a lot of magic - even when they were wrapped up in the Devil’s Snare, they really had fake vines wrapped around them, with people controlling all the puppet limbs! They also got to hold a three dimensional Marauder's Map. It wasn’t all fun and games though - the young actors also had to face enormous replicas of terrifying creatures like Basilisks and super-sized tarantulas. All these practical effects used to bring the magic just makes us appreciate these films even more!
